Abstract

The use of Papuan red fruit as a supplementation ingredient in diluents is one solution to the high price of diluent raw materials. The purpose of this study was to determine the effect of using a diluent supplemented with red fruit extract (RFE) in various levels on the quality of liquid semen of Ongle crossbred cattle during storage at equilibration temperature. The research was conducted in the Animal Health Laboratory of Semangga District and the Independent Laboratory. The research method and design used were a completely randomized design (CRD) with 4 treatments and 5 replications. This study used 4 diluting treatments, namely P0 = Tris egg yolk (TKT), P1 = (TKT + 0.1 ml RFE), P2 = (TKT + 0.3 ml RFE) and P3 = (TKT + 0.5 ml RFE). Semen was collected using an artificial vagina, immediately after the semen storage was evaluated macroscopically and microscopically. The homogenized semen was divided into 4 tubes, then put the semen into the straw as much as 0.25 ml. The next process is equilibration at 5oC for 2, 4, 6, 8 hours and evaluation of spermatozoa longivity is carried out at pots equilibration. The results showed that there was a difference (P <0.05) in the longivity of spermatozoa in P3 treatment against the control. In conclusion, it can be concluded that the red fruit extract supplementation in egg yolk tris diluent was able to maintain spermatozoa longevity.

Abstract

The Mx gene (Myxovirus) is a gene that functions to control the immunity of poultry against viral diseases. This gene is a native antiviral and is able to respond to influenza virus infections such as avian influenza. This study aims to identify the diversity of the Mx gene in ducks using the PCR-RFLP (Polymerase Chain Reaction-Restriction Fragment Length Polymorphism) molecular technique. The number of samples used were thirteen ducks from Indragiri Hulu Regency (Riau Province). The restriction site of the Mx gene using the Rsa1 enzyme is in the base sequence GTN|NAC. There are two alleles namely A and G, and three genotypes, AA, AG and GG. The results showed that the Mx gene in ducks was monomorphic. The frequency of the resistant allele (A) is 0%, while the frequency of the susceptible allele (G) is 100%.

Abstract

Musi Banyuasin is one of the regency in South Sumatra Province. The population of cattle based on 2017 data is 31,834 heads spread across 14 districts. The type of cattle that is mostly kept is Bali cattle which are scattered throughout the Musi Banyuasin. SPR Maju Bersama is one of the SPRs under the guidance of IPB University in Musi Banyuasin. The purpose of this study was to evaluate the male Bali cattle breeding program at SPR Maju Bersama. The method used in this study is purposive sampling with the observed parameters, namely the pattern of maintenance, the mating system of male sires and the relationship between the rearing system and the results of the livestock BCS assessment as a program evaluation parameter. The results of this study indicate that SPR Maju Bersama is quite good in carrying out the male Bali cattle breeding program as superior breeds. The BCS value is at a score of 3 with a total of 53 heads from the total sample population of 89 heads.
